Moses Haughton the elder
Moses Haughton the elder (1735–1804) was a painter and illustrator.
Also recorded as Moses I Haughton; Moses Houghton; Moses Haughton the Elder; Moses, I Haughton; Moses Haughton; Moses, the elder Haughton.
Overview
Born at Staffordshire in 1735, died at Birmingham in 1804.
In detail
Subjects and genres recorded for the work are portrait.
Work by Moses Haughton the elder is recorded in the collections of Tate, National Museum Cardiff, Laing Art Gallery and Ham House.
